Description:
A large antique French Sterling Silver serving knife or slice. Rococo in design with flowing foliage, shells, roses, and a large cartouche. The finishing touch on this substantial piece …the end of the knife has been beautifully detailed with the smiling faces of cherubs or putti. Marked or punched for .950 sterling silver designated by the Minerva 1st mark, the bigorne/ counter-mark, and also bears a maker’s marks for AH. This may possibly be the mark for Alfred Hector (star and five branches 1881/1913). I can make out the star and what appears to be branches. Measurements; 11 ½” long, 1 ¾” at the widest point Weight; 135 gr approx. Condition; very good, handle is tight, no major dents.
